> eInk is the right display tech. It's interesting and I clicked on the OP, but why? The variable ambient light conditions, refresh rate, etc would seem to favor standard LCD/etc. Battery capacity isn't much of an issue for a small screen, and weight carried by the bicycle.
eInk is like a piece of paper, which gets MORE visible in the sun, but standard touchscreen LCDs/OLEDs get harder to see. I am not sure about the physics/reasons for this. Phones also aggressively dim screens to conserve energy and lower temperatures. Phones absorb a lot of sunlight, so a white eInk display is brilliant in that regard.
